HIDES, SKINS AND TALLOW.

SALE AT PARNELL. At yesterday's sale of sheepskins and hides at the J'arnell stores there was a full attendance of buyers representing shippers, tanners and fellmongers. There was a steady demand throughout for all classes of hides, with values firm. Dried sheepskins sold better, wTiiie salted 'Skins and tallow were unchanged. Following arc tho quotations: — Sheepskins.—Dry: Halfbrcd and fine crossbred. 9%d per lb; medium crossbred, 7%d to B%d; coarse crossbred, 5%d to 7d; half to three-quarter wool, 6d; quarter to half wool, 5%d; quarter wool, 5',4d; lambs,, 6d to S9id; pelts, 3d to s*Ad. Salted: Best. 0/ to 6/4 each; good, 5/1 to 5/10; medium, 4/6 to 5/; lambs, 1/ to 1/6; pelts, lOd to 1/6. Hides. —Abattoirs: Extra heavy ox, 7%d per lb; heavy, 7d; medium, 6%d; light, 6%d; extra heavy cow, 6%d; heavy, 6%d; medium, 6%d; light. 6%d; kips. 6%d; yearlings, 8d; best calf, 11/Vid; good, 8d to lOVid. Country butchers: Extra heavy ox, 6%d; heavy, 6%d; medium, 6%d; light, 6d; extra heavy cow, 5%d; heavy, medium and light, 5%d: kips, 6d; yearlings, 7d; best calf, 10% d; good. B%d •to lO'Ad; inferior and damaged, 4d to 6%d. Tallow. —Best mixed, 28/ per cwt; medium, 25/6; poor, 22/.
